The video tutorial demonstrates how to solve a proportion using the cross product method. The instructor explains the process of multiplying across the equal sign, simplifying the equation, and solving for the variable X. The final solution is simplified to X = 5/6, and the instructor emphasizes the importance of writing out steps to avoid mistakes.
